What is a senior analytics engineer?

A Senior Analytics Engineer is a data professional who bridges the gap between data engineering and data analysis. They design, build, and maintain data pipelines, data models, and analytics infrastructure to ensure that data is reliable, accessible, and well-structured for analysis. Typically, they work with tools like SQL, dbt, and cloud data warehouses, collaborating closely with data analysts and business stakeholders to deliver actionable insights. Their role often involves optimizing data workflows, implementing best practices, and mentoring junior team members.

How does a senior analytics engineer typically collaborate with data scientists and business stakeholders?

Senior Analytics Engineers play a vital role in bridging the gap between raw data and actionable insights. They work closely with data scientists to ensure that data pipelines and models are robust, scalable, and well-documented. Additionally, they frequently meet with business stakeholders to understand reporting needs and translate them into technical requirements, ensuring that analytics solutions align with organizational goals. This collaborative approach helps maintain data quality and accelerates the delivery of meaningful analyses across te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ior analytics eng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Analytics Engineer, you need strong expertise in data modeling, SQL, data warehousing, and analytics, typically backed by a degree in computer science, mathematics, or a related field. Proficiency with tools such as dbt, Python, cloud data platforms (like Snowflake or BigQuery), and experience with BI tools are commonly required, along with certifications in analytics or cloud technologies being a plus.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and stakeholder management skills help you translate business requirements into robust data solutions. These skills ensure data integrity, drive actionable insights, and support effective decision-making across the organization.

This role in summary
Whirlpool is looking for a qualified candidate for the role of Electrical Engineer (Senior Analyst) for the InSinkErator Business Unit located in Mount Pleasant, WI.
This an onsite role.
This role will lead the development and sustaining support of motors for residential food waste disposers. The candidate will be responsible for driving performance, cost, quality, and energy efficiency improvements across all electrical systems and motor technologies.
The role demands strong technical depth in electromechanical systems, cross-functional collaboration, and structured problem solving to ensure Whirlpool products deliver differentiated performance and reliability in alignment with global standards.
Your responsibilities will include
  • Lead electrical system development and validation for new and existing disposer products.
  • Provide ongoing technical support to manufacturing teams to resolve production issues and optimize assembly processes.
  • Collaborate with suppliers and internal teams to develop specifications, drawings, and validation plans.
  • Conduct performance, reliability, and durability testing, analyzing data to identify improvement opportunities.
  • Work closely with Advanced Development, NPD and Sustaining teams to ensure motor designs meet performance targets.
  • Manage DFMEA and test plan creation for all electrical systems and motors.
  • Define and optimize motor sizing, torque, and speed characteristics based on system performance requirements and product configurations.
  • Drive motor technology selection and standardization across platforms.
  • Laad simulation-based analysis to validate torque, current, and temperature performance under different load conditions.
  • Benchmark competitor products and identify opportunities for cost, quality, and innovation improvement.
  • Support resolution of field and quality issues, identify root causes, and define permanent corrective actions.
